What Counts As Emergency Plumbing


While a plumbing emergency isn't specifically one-size-fits-all, there can be many telltale signs of a plumbing emergency. Basically a plumbing emergency is any type of plumbing-related problem that can trigger damage to a residential or commercial property or its occupants.

Water Not Heating Properly


If your water is running yet you can not get it cozy enough to have a bath or perhaps comfortably clean your hands there may be an issue with your plumbing's heating system. This is typically an issue that can be fixed in an issue of mins. Initially, inspect the breaker button for the water heater in your fuse panel to guarantee it hasn't been stumbled, if it has merely snap it right into the off setting as well as back on once more. If the breaker hasn't been tripped, the concern could be with the heating element for your water heater, in this case, it's ideal to call an expert to test, as well as potentially change the negative component.

Prepare a Plumbing Emergency Kit


To prepare yourself for any possible plumbing emergency, it would be best if you already had your own plumber’s kit. This way, you can immediately take care of the problem once they arrive at your place. In preparing such a kit, make sure that all of these items are within easy reach: wrench and adjustable wrench (to remove nuts), tongs (for turning screws on faucets or valves), screwdriver set with a flat head and Phillips-head bits, plunger/plunger cup assembly (with rubber flange insert), snake wire or auger cable style hand tool, flashlight with batteries and extra bulbs.

Do Not Flush Anything That Doesn’t Belong in the Toilet


Toilet paper is the only thing that belongs in a toilet. If you have to flush something else down your drain or sink, then it doesn’t belong there and certainly not in the toilet! Most of the time these items don’t cause any problems for homeowners, but some can get stuck which causes an emergency plumbing issue. Some of the things that you should never flush include sanitary items such as pads and tampons. These products can cause a blockage in your pipes which leads to an emergency plumbing issue. If this happens, then it’s important to call a plumber right away so they can fix the problem before it gets worse or causes any problems for your home.



Diapers are another item that you should never flush down the toilet because they can also cause a major blockage in your plumbing system which leads to an emergency plumbing issue. Once again, if this happens then it’s important to call a plumber quickly before any damage is done.
